Mystery Surrounds Balls Future at Posh


Mystery surrounds the future of David Ball at Peterborough United.

Ball was due to link up with League One Brentford on Tuesday for his first training session with them, but Posh pulled the plug on the deal late on Monday.

Brentford boss Uwe Rosler said: 'We thought we had the deal in place but we received a call on Monday night saying the move was off.

'We were surprised, as was the player, who was due to train with us on Tuesday morning.

'But we are moving on now. Our intention is to bring a striker in before the transfer window closes at the end of the month.'

The reason behind the sudden collapse of the loan deal is still a mystery to all outside the walls of London Road.

Posh did see the departure of loanee Josh Thompson on Monday when he was recalled by parent club Celtic. He has since signed on loan at League One basement team Chesterfield.

With a number of players still out injured and with Thompson departing, it could just be to bolster the squad or it could be a better deal has come along!
